Understanding the Tampa Personal Injury Market

Before diving into specific tactics, it is essential to grasp the unique characteristics of the Tampa legal landscape. The city’s population includes a mix of long-term residents, retirees, and seasonal tourists, all of whom may require legal assistance after an accident. Additionally, Tampa’s extensive highway system, including I-275 and I-4, contributes to a high rate of motor vehicle collisions. This creates a constant demand for attorneys who specialize in car accidents, truck accidents, and motorcycle injuries. Furthermore, the region’s humid climate and older infrastructure lead to property hazards, resulting in premises liability cases.

To effectively capture personal injury leads near Tampa FL, you must tailor your marketing efforts to these local realities. This means optimizing your website for location-specific keywords, participating in community events, and building relationships with local medical providers who can refer clients. It also involves understanding the typical client journey: an injured person often searches for symptoms or legal options late at night, then compares multiple firms the next morning. Your goal is to be the first firm they see and the one that offers the most compelling reason to call.

Building a High-Converting Website and Landing Pages

Your website is your digital storefront, and for many potential clients, it is the first impression of your firm. A generic, slow-loading site will drive prospects away before they even read your content. To generate quality personal injury leads near Tampa FL, your website must be fast, mobile-friendly, and designed to convert visitors into leads. Start with a clear, above-the-fold headline that addresses the visitor’s pain point, such as “Injured in a Tampa Car Accident? We Can Help You Recover.” Follow this with a prominent call-to-action button, like “Get a Free Case Review.”

Landing pages dedicated to specific practice areas are even more effective. For example, create separate pages for car accidents, truck accidents, slip and falls, and wrongful death. Each page should include:

  • Detailed information about the type of case and how local laws apply.
  • Testimonials from past clients in the Tampa area.
  • A brief form asking for the visitor’s name, phone number, and a short description of their accident.
  • A clear statement that the consultation is free and confidential.

These targeted pages improve your search engine rankings for long-tail keywords and provide a tailored experience that builds trust. Additionally, ensure your site loads in under three seconds, as slow load times significantly increase bounce rates. Remember, the goal is to make it as easy as possible for a potential client to take the next step and contact your firm.

Leveraging Paid Advertising for Immediate Results

While organic search engine optimization (SEO) is a long-term investment, pay-per-click (PPC) advertising can deliver personal injury leads near Tampa FL almost immediately. Platforms like Google Ads allow you to bid on keywords such as “Tampa car accident lawyer” or “personal injury attorney near me.” The key to success is precise targeting and compelling ad copy. You can narrow your audience by location, device, and even time of day to ensure your ads are seen by the most relevant prospects.

However, PPC can become expensive quickly if not managed correctly. Personal injury keywords are among the most competitive in the legal industry, with cost-per-clicks often exceeding $50 or more. To maximize your budget, focus on high-intent keywords that indicate the user is ready to hire, such as “hire a Tampa injury lawyer” or “best personal injury attorney in Tampa.” Also, use ad extensions to include your phone number, location, and links to specific practice areas. It is crucial to track conversions meticulously, using call tracking and form submissions to measure which ads and keywords produce actual leads. The Role of Content Marketing and SEO

Content marketing is the backbone of sustainable lead generation. By creating informative, authoritative content that answers the questions your potential clients are asking, you can attract organic traffic that converts into personal injury leads near Tampa FL. Start by identifying common search queries, such as “What to do after a car accident in Florida?” or “How long do I have to file a personal injury claim in Tampa?” Then, write detailed blog posts, guides, and FAQ pages that provide clear, helpful answers.

Each piece of content should be optimized for local SEO. This means including the city name in your titles, headers, and meta descriptions. Additionally, build local citations by listing your firm on Google Business Profile, Yelp, and other legal directories. Encourage satisfied clients to leave reviews, as positive ratings boost your visibility in local search results. A well-executed content strategy not only drives traffic but also establishes your firm as a trusted authority, making it more likely that a visitor will choose you when they need legal help.

Evaluating Lead Quality and Exclusivity

Not all lead generation companies operate with the same standards. Some sell the same lead to multiple firms, creating a race to contact the prospect first. This model often results in lower conversion rates and frustrated clients. When evaluating a provider for personal injury leads near Tampa FL, ask specific questions: Are the leads exclusive to one attorney in my geographic area? How are the leads verified? Can I get a refund for bad leads? A transparent provider will answer these questions clearly and offer a trial period to test the quality.

Another factor to consider is the source of the leads. Leads generated from organic search or targeted advertising campaigns tend to be higher quality than those from random banner ads. Ideally, the provider should have a robust verification process that includes checking the lead’s contact information, case details, and intent to hire. By choosing a trusted partner, you can build a predictable pipeline of cases that grows your practice steadily.

Intake Systems: Converting Leads into Clients

Even the best personal injury leads near Tampa FL are worthless if your intake system fails to convert them. Speed is critical here. Studies show that contacting a lead within five minutes increases the chance of conversion by over 100 times. Therefore, your firm must have a process in place to respond immediately, whether through a live answering service, an automated SMS system, or a dedicated intake specialist who monitors leads 24/7.

Your intake script should be designed to build rapport and gather essential information quickly. Start by empathizing with the prospect’s situation, then ask about the accident details, injuries, and any insurance information. Avoid pressuring the caller; instead, focus on providing value and demonstrating your expertise. After the call, send a follow-up email or text with a summary of your conversation and the next steps. Many firms also use a CRM (customer relationship management) system to track leads and automate follow-ups, ensuring no potential client falls through the cracks. Compliance and Ethical Considerations

When generating personal injury leads near Tampa FL, you must adhere to strict ethical guidelines set by the Florida Bar and state regulations. This includes rules regarding attorney advertising, solicitation, and client confidentiality. For example, you cannot make false or misleading statements in your ads, and you must clearly disclose that you are a law firm. Additionally, if you purchase leads, ensure the lead generation platform complies with the Telephone Consumer Protection Act (TCPA) and does not use deceptive practices to obtain consent.

It is also wise to have a written agreement with any lead provider outlining their compliance responsibilities. Avoid platforms that use aggressive telemarketing or robocalls, as these can lead to fines and damage your firm’s reputation. By operating ethically, you not only protect yourself from legal trouble but also build a brand that clients trust. Remember, a satisfied client is your best source of future referrals.

Frequently Asked Questions

How much do personal injury leads in Tampa cost?

The cost varies widely based on the source and exclusivity. Exclusive, verified leads from a reputable provider can range from $30 to $100 per lead, while non-exclusive leads may be cheaper but convert at a lower rate. PPC leads can cost $50 to $200 per click, depending on keyword competition.

Are exclusive leads worth the higher price?

Yes, in most cases. Exclusive leads are sold only to one attorney in your area, meaning you are not competing with other firms for the same prospect. This often results in a higher conversion rate and a better return on investment, especially for high-value personal injury cases.

How quickly should I contact a new lead?

Ideally, within five minutes. The faster you respond, the higher the likelihood of converting the lead into a client. Use automated tools like SMS and email to send an immediate acknowledgment and then follow up with a personal phone call.

Can I generate leads without a website?

While possible, it is challenging. A website serves as your digital hub where prospects can learn about your firm, read reviews, and contact you. Without one, you miss out on organic search traffic and credibility. Even a simple, well-optimized site is better than none.
